Optimal Timing for Residential Air Testing

Scheduling tests during key periods ensures accurate detection of airborne pollutants and indoor air quality assessment.

Residential air testing is most effective when conducted during specific times to ensure accurate results and optimal indoor air quality assessment. The timing of testing can influence the detection of airborne pollutants, mold spores, and other contaminants. Proper scheduling helps identify issues related to seasonal changes, occupancy patterns, and environmental conditions.

Spring Testing

Spring is ideal for air testing as it captures airborne allergens and mold spores that become prevalent during this season due to increased humidity and pollen.

Fall Testing

Fall testing helps detect mold growth and indoor air quality issues caused by seasonal changes and increased indoor activity during colder months.

Post-Remediation Testing

Conduct testing after mold remediation or air quality improvements to verify the effectiveness of cleaning and treatment processes.

Before Major Renovations

Testing prior to renovations can identify existing air quality issues and prevent the spread of contaminants during construction.

Season/TimingIdeal Testing Focus
SpringAllergens, mold spores, pollen
FallMold growth, indoor pollutants
Post-RemediationEffectiveness of cleaning
Before RenovationsExisting air quality issues
During OccupancyOngoing air quality monitoring
WinterHeating-related pollutants
SummerHumidity-related mold issues
